Once you were Real, Faded, then Gone…

I have a great imagination &
I don’t feel like missing you so
I’ll play pretend…

Welcome to my life, imaginary friend!
We have a heart-load of **** to share;
it’s been so long.
Tell me of your travels...
Of those new to your life. . . the losses, too.
Share stories of your family
Tell what warms your heart
confide in me the highs and lows, the everything

Then I’ll speak of mine…but. . .

here's the thing about imaginary friends…
I cannot know of you; silence is your truth
Ridiculously I converse, one-sided…

for (imaginary) friendship's sake
